Georgous Aesthetic Bar is the first of its kind in Kansas City, unlike any other med spa you may have experienced. In 2019, when Georgia Cirese and her daughter, Mary Katelyn opened the Bar, they defined a new category of boutique clinics. With Georgia at the helm, it quickly became a premier facility for hundreds of patients seeking medical procedures in a comfortable, spa-like environment. 

Cirese is a Certified Aesthetic Nurse Specialist (CANS) and Registered Nurse (RN). She is also widely recognized as a trainer and mentor in her field. With education and training being a passion of hers, she incorporates time with the Aesthetic Advancements Institute, a premier continuing medical education training organization, to teach others across the country. 

The Kansas City region benefits from the skill and talent she brings to the area as a nationally recognized master injector and skilled cosmetic expert. She leads her team in administering non-surgical aesthetic treatments such as wrinkle relaxers (Botox®, Dysport® and Jeuveau®), cosmetic fillers, thread lifts and laser therapy treatments, such as IPL, BBL, HALO and hair removal. Her clinic also specializes in chemical peels, microneedling, CoolSculpting®, Juvederm® filler, DiamondGlow® facial treatment and Radiesse® BootyLift. These science-backed treatments are focused on addressing concerns of aging, pigmentation, sun damage, acne, skin texture and body contouring, while physician grade skincare products are also available.

With each treatment, Georgia and her team deliver on their philosophy of looking fresh and natural, believing that “the best aesthetic treatments are undetectable”. You can visit Georgous Aesthetic Bar two blocks north of the Country Club Plaza.
